What starts as a simple vehicle stop can lead to major discoveries—as seen in two recent incidents, according to the Orange County Sheriff Department’s North Patrol.
On October 24, at around 11 p.m., North SET Deputies conducted a vehicle stop in unincorporated North Orange County, recovering approximately 40 grams of fentanyl, 30 Xanax bars, 10 grams of methamphetamine, and $538 in U.S. currency.
The following day, on October 25, deputies conducted a vehicle stop in Midway City, locating ¼ pound of methamphetamine for sales, drug paraphernalia, personal identifying information used for check fraud, and confirming felony warrants. Two suspects were taken into custody…
